In this book, an international team of authors presents a comprehensive collection of reviews on iron uptake and metabolism in various microorganisms including rhizobia, Bordetella, Shigella, E. coli, Erwinia, Vibrio, Aeromonas, Francisella, Bacteroides, Campylobacter, cyanobacteria, Bacillus, staphylococci and yeasts. An entire chapter is dedicated to siderophores and another to heme uptake. The volume provides an expert and timely summary of current knowledge, with a focus on molecular and genetic aspects, and highlights some of the most exciting recent developments.
